Based on this extremely limited analysis, I might argue that sch_fq does no= t, actually, scale well to millions of flows at gigE, and that there are more things we could do to reduce host buffering than we have done already, in anything= , with tons of local flows extant. But my kernel and test rig are suspect, and I would suggest that someone with a testbed (and not on vacation) attempt a gigE test with and without offloads, with the qdisc changing on the host, only, on a modern kernel. Each one of these is 50 flows up, 1 flow down, just tracking the up. And there really aren=E2=80=99t very many collisions there, so the = FQ logic is still mostly working as designed. > >> * As does cake flowblind, but less so > > That is surprising, actually. With shaping off, all packets having the s= ame DSCP and with FQ disabled, it should behave similarly to ns4_codel (as = I used codel4.h as a basis for codel5.h). That the three =E2=80=9Cway=E2= =80=9D stats counters remain at zero confirms that the FQ logic is being co= mpletely bypassed (since if the hash was fixed at zero and the FQ logic sti= ll ran, you=E2=80=99d see at least some misses and indirect hits as well as= a lot of collisions, since the set-associative logic would still search th= e first 8 queues). > > But I didn=E2=80=99t notice an ns4_codel test run in your post. A direct= comparison might be apt, and then we can look at the differences between n= s4_codel and the other codels in isolation. > > - Jonathan Morton > --=20 Dave T=C3=A4ht Open Networking needs
